Legal Resources and Support Networks for Victims
For those who have experienced abuse at the Piney Ridge Center, seeking legal recourse and support is a crucial step in healing and recovery. There are various organizations dedicated to assisting victims navigate the complex legal system and find the resources they need. These include legal aid societies that offer free or low-cost legal services specifically tailored for abuse survivors. These groups can provide advice on filing civil lawsuits, understanding one’s rights, and navigating protective orders.
Support networks play a vital role in empowering Piney Ridge Center abuse victims. Local victim advocacy organizations offer confidential counseling, support groups, and resources to help individuals process their experiences and rebuild their lives. These networks ensure that victims are not alone, providing emotional support, practical assistance, and a sense of community as they recover and move forward.
